We will cap retries at three, surface exhaustion errors directly in the customer-facing job status, and add a queue-depth alert. Support should tell affected customers that stalled jobs were requeued automatically. The full timeline, affected job classes, and talking points are on the internal page below.

operations page: https://vault.qorvelcorp.example/settings

# Break-Glass: Catalog Cache Invalidation

Scope: the Pinrow product catalog at Veldstone Retail. If stale prices persist after a purge and the Hollowmere invalidation queue is wedged, use break-glass to flush the edge tier directly. Contractors: get verbal sign-off from the catalog lead first. Steps: open the Hollowmere admin shell, select emergency-flush, confirm the tenant, and run it once — repeated flushes thrash the origin. Access is logged and expires after 20 minutes. Unseal the admin shell with the passphrase below.

recovery phrase for kahop-tajog: istix-casvan

Welcome aboard. This is the weekly release note for FeedCheck, our podcast feed validator at Larkwhistle Media. Version 2.4 adds stricter enclosure-size checks and better handling of malformed pubDate fields. Nothing in this build changes the CLI flags, so existing scripts on the Penhallow servers should run unmodified. Staging validation passed overnight; the full regression suite finished clean this morning. If you see failures, flag them in the release channel before Thursday. The trace token for this build follows.

build token for fajep-yajof: htk9_7d88c0238

## Releases

The user module is now cut from the Brackenport monolith and ships as `userkit` on its own cadence. Tag `userkit-vX.Y.Z`, run `make relcheck`, and confirm the shim layer in the monolith pins the matching version. CI blocks merges if contract tests drift. Release artifacts must be signed before publishing; use the key below.

rollout seal: bky4_x7Gc